Output 3e3db68c7c1fa6ec75e4abbc9b1d78fea09f99c90e6b00d6d5f16bd3d654852a:1

value
60686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f218262a8fdca77e203f5b24033c3641821680 OP_EQUAL
address
3DuFp4oJXe84UpEDThHoNWtRgtkroLNX1Q
transaction
3e3db68c7c1fa6ec75e4abbc9b1d78fea09f99c90e6b00d6d5f16bd3d654852a
spent
true